Kauai Camping Guide & Camping Permits FAQ

Can I head to any beach to camp?

You can drive up to any beach, nevertheless, you can only put up your camp in designated camping grounds. This is the standard practice here on Kauai. We will provide you with a list of the top locations to check out and also to go camping. Please be aware that driving on the beaches isn’t allowed on Kauai.

Are we allowed to camp in the wild or are we only able to go to official camping sites? If so, how much does it cost?

No, wild camping isn’t permitted on the island of Kauai. You should only go camping in specified areas with a current camping permit. The fee is about $3 per night in the majority of Kauai county parks, though private camp sites may be a little more. One advantage of these campgrounds is that you have full access to amenities, including showers, bathrooms and picnic tables. Please keep in mind that if you decide to camp on the county camp sites, you are only permitted to set up the ground tent.

Where can I park and sleep with a roof top tent truck?

  • Kōkeʻe State Park (need camping permit): Kokee Rd, Hwy 550, Kekaha, HI 96752
  • Sugi Grove Campground (need camping permit): Access from MohihiCamp 10 Road, starting 100 yards past Kōkeʻe State Park headquarters along Highway 550. Latitude 22.13 N, Longitude -159.622 W.
  • YMCA of Kaua’i (camping without a permit but reservation is required): 4477 Nuhou St, Lihue, HI 96766
  • Kumu Camp: Anahola Beach Retreat (camping without a permit but reservation is required): 4275 Poha Rd, Anahola, HI 96703
  • Camp Nau’e YMCA (camping without a permit but reservation is required): 7420 Kuhio Hwy, Hanalei, Kauai, HI 96714
  • Camp Slogget operated by YWCA Kaua’i in beautiful Koke’e State Park (camping without a permit but reservation is required): get directions from their website https://ywcakauai.org/camp-sloggett
  • Camp Hale Koa – private campground in Koke’e State Park (camping without a permit but reservation is required): this is for larger groups only, for more information, please go to their website http://camphalekoa.com

Do we have to get Kauai camping permits before our arrival in Kauai?

It is a better to get your Kauai camping license before your trip. For the majority of private camping grounds, which we always recommend first, you can get your permits online and also in person in the designated office.

If you choose to camp at a county campground and use a ground tent, you may ask for permits by going to the “County of Kauai Camping Information” web page.

In advance, the charges are $3 per night for nonresidents of Hawaii. Accepted payment methods with this application are cashier’s checks as well as money orders. Nevertheless, you don’t necessarily have to book your camping licenses before your arrival. You could also obtain them at the designated permit offices in Kauai, which is typically easier.

How long does it take to obtain the camping permits?

No matter whether you choose to go to a state or private campsite, both online and in person reservations are possible. Please note that if you choose to stay at a county camping ground, mail-in applications are easy to submit, but it can take quite a while to receive your permits. You may choose to obtain your permits upon arrival to Kauai at the different permit offices on the island; in-person you will get them right away.
